10 Flirty Moves for Introverted Women to Make His Heart Skip a Beat

There’s something mysterious about quiet women that makes them downright irresistible. These flirty moves for introverted women give them an unfair advantage over our meager male hearts.

And let’s be clear when I say introverted I don’t mean deathly fearful to talk to and meet men, I just mean not shamefully outgoing and forward.

It Just Takes One Move to Render Him Helpless

No need to try anything fancy. Just show him that you approve of him and that you give him the “green light” to advance and make the next meaningful move.

The average person will not approach other people unless they feel the other person wants to meet them.

As men, we enjoy the excitement of trying to dominate women’s hearts, some of us call it “hunting”. But we still want to limit the risk of rejection.

No man enjoys outright rejection.

These simple flirty moves for introverted women limit the risk for him while still letting him feel the excitement of “making a move on you”.

I’m not asking you to ask for his phone number or ask to meet up with him, rather just give him the “right to advance”.

Here’s how to do it…

Simple Flirty Moves for Introverted Women that Grant Him the Right to Advance

1. Eye Contact

I’m not asking for much here. Just hold eye contact for 2 to 3 seconds. Let him know you mean to look and that you enjoy the view. He should know that you did it on purpose.

Sometimes making eye contact is accidental.

But when the same woman catches our glance on multiple occasions or holds it steady rather than looking away, we know this means more than a coincidence.

And that’s all the nudge we need to make a move.

If he doesn’t make eye contact first, would you have the courage to do it?

2. Smile

Now that you got his attention smile. Nothing gaudy. Just a quick smile to say hello.

The key here is to both 1) make eye contact and 2) smile at the same time.

This gets me (and every other guy) every time.

That’s really all it takes.

The entire list here of flirty moves for introverted women is simple- nothing fancy, just easy ways to get a man’s attention if you need to.

3. Say Hello

Of course, if you can muster up the courage, actually say, “Hello.”

Do so softly.

And do it while smiling- again, nothing big, just a small smile.

This is so adorable.

He will know it took courage- that makes it all the more irresistible.

4. Introduce Yourself

When you come across a guy you’ve never met, or you know of him but you’ve never spoken consider just starting with a subtle introduction.

That might be all you need to win him over and open things up for him to want to know more about you.

Just simply state your name and state that it’s nice to meet him.

He will follow suit and introduce himself.

5. Compliment Him

Subtly draw attention to yourself by complimenting something about him.

He’ll have no choice but to find you attractive for it.

Not sure what to compliment?

Try any of these:

  • Something he’s wearing
  • Something he’s carrying.
  • A sticker, pin, patch on his coat, bag, or laptop
  • The way he does something
  • His laugh
  • And you can gather up enough courage and really want to make his heart thump, his smile or eyes.

What do you say?

Just simply say either “I like (fill in the blank)” or “Nice (fill in the blank).”

He knows you’re normally more on the quiet side which makes you that much more attractive when you show a bit of courage to break out of your shell.

6. Address Him By Name

Nothing sounds sweeter when a girl calls us by name, except calling us handsome of course.

Whenever a girl says my name, especially when I see her more on the shy side, my heart pounds.

I think, “What about me made her open up?”

It makes me feel special, and thus, I have no choice but to find her attractive for it.

7. Wave

There’s something irresistible about an introverted girl waving to say “hello”. It’s just so cute.

It shows that you’re approachable.

If you want a man to make a move then he must feel like you want him to approach.

8. Straighten His Collar

Pretend to be doing something nice for him, just straighten up his collar. Pretend to straighten it. He won’t know the difference.

Or pretend to remove a piece of lint from his shirt.

Having you close will make his blood pump faster.

9. Laugh at His Jokes

Most of us men cannot resist finding a girl attractive when she laughs at our jokes, as long as she doesn’t do it in an obnoxious and annoying way.

Just like you, we want to feel appreciated and liked.

And when you laugh at his jokes it makes him feel accepted and that he can entertain you.

All of those feelings serve as nudges to give him the confidence to proceed and make the next move.

Remember leave the door open, let him pass through.

10. Touch His Arm

Any time you can get up close within his personal space and while showing no fear, like you enjoy being next to him, his heart will pause.

But when you touch him, even when innocently just touching his arm for a second or lower back, you place a goddess-like spell over him.

The flirty moves for introverted women in this blog post serve as your sign of approval.

You are saying I like you. I approve of you, but now it’s your turn.

Almost like you’re playing a game of tag.

Now he chases.

Have You Tried Any of These Flirty Moves for Introverted Women Before?

10 Simple Freebie Ideas and Examples for Content Creators (in any Niche)

Giving away a freebie (or lead magnet) will accelerate the speed at which you add to your email list or build up a fanbase of supporters who trust your advice and take your recommendations.

One of the easiest ways I get my subscribers to open their emails is to offer them a gift related to the topic of the blog post they chose to read.

This gift helps them solve a problem. These simple freebie ideas will show you how to easily make something useful to your visitors that will turn them into subscribers.

But you don’t have to start from scratch and cause yourself a headache when creating your lead magnet.

All you have to do is use the content you already have and recreate it to a different format.

Check out these ways in which to recreate your existing content into a freebie.

Examples of Existing Content Turned into a Freebie

I’ve done each of these simple freebie ideas myself, in some cases, to give to my current email subscribers instead of offering them in exchange for a new subscriber’s email.

1. Formulas/Templates

Formulas and templates make for a useful training freebie.

And it works for any niche.

Your audience can simply swap out elements on a template or fill in the formula to customize it to their own needs.

Here are some examples of templates:

  • Social media images
  • eBook covers
  • vocabulary tables
  • printable cards
  • calendars for different occasions
  • idea maps
  • brainstorm lists
  • categorized checklists
  • eBook designs and layouts
  • Recipe cards for food or drink

And here are some examples of formulas:

  • Fill-in-the-blank headlines
  • Step-by-step blueprint of action steps
  • Any pattern to follow (in learning foreign languages, reading music, for test-taking)
  • Fill-in-the-blank phraseology scripts
  • A simple memorization technique or acroynm to help accomplish a task

I’ve created fill-in-the-blank text message scripts for women to follow and customize their own to send to their boyfriend or man they are dating.

2. Copy-and-Paste, Ready-to-Send Examples

One of my favorite examples of a freebie to grow my email list or even create a product for sale is a list of copy-and-paste, ready-to-send phrases.

One of my most successful examples of these freebies (and products for sale) is an eBook of copy-and-paste flirty text messages that women can send to men.

These are similar to templates except they are not as artistic, just straight-up text.

And they’re designed for communications; either how to engage in a conversation, respond to someone else, or just to make someone feel good.

Here are some examples of these that your subscribers can copy, paste, and then send:

  • General jokes to make people laugh
  • Inspirational quotes
  • Lead generation emails to set up sales appointments
  • Heart-warming compliments to loved ones
  • Sales rebuttals to prospect objections
  • Conversation starters for couples
  • Conversation starters for meeting new people
  • How-to replies to difficult questions
  • Questions to get someone to open up and share feelings

I love copy-and-paste lead magnets because I already made the content elsewhere. They are the easiest of all the simple freebie ideas you’ll find.

3. Quizzes to Teach and Share Knowledge

Sure you can use a fancy tool like Leadquizzes or even try out Typeform for free, but I simply use Google Forms.

Watch some YouTube videos on how to make a quiz.

I creatively built one to teach my subscribers how to write successful flirty text messages to get the best responses.

Just create multiple-choice quizzes and provide an explanation of what makes one choice better than the rest.

The explanations are what teach and share the knowledge of the material.

Check out these examples of quizzes that teach:

  • Foreign language vocabulary and grammar
  • Industry terminology
  • Arrange the steps in order of any “How-to” process
  • Exam prep course
  • Choose the best blog post headline for traffic
  • Choose the best ad headline to convert clickthroughs
  • Select the best image for this ad headline
  • Fix this problem, choose the best solution

4. Quizzes to Measure Level of Knowledge

You can apply also determine how well your subscribers know a topic by providing a scorecard for the number of correct answers to a quiz.

“All 10 Correct= Expert Level”, “Only One Correct= Time to Study Harder”.

The quiz examples above in number 3 suffice, the difference is the scorecard at the end.

How you present the results and scorecard is up to you.

You can ask them to opt-in to receive it or provide it before opt-in and then offer another enticing freebie to subscribe.

The scorecard can be a PDF, blog post, or even a video of you explaining the results.

5. Slide Shows

Not many know this, but Canva is a great tool to create slide shows with audio. You can now also create video screenshots.

Slide shows work well for How-to’s or to repurpose another piece of content you’ve created.

For example, choose your favorite pieces of advice and explain each in more detail.

Here are some simple freebie ideas of slide shows you could use:

Tips to potty train babies

How to train a dog to do tricks

Visual recipes, step-by-step guides

Checklists of tools or supplies (for recipes, photography sessions, campling trips, etc)

How to create digital products for personal use (budget tables, spending trackers, shopping lists, inventory tables)

… or even to convert your list posts into visual displays to make them more appealing to view.

Here are some examples of list posts turned into visual slide shows:

  • My 10 Favorite Romantic Small Town Getaways
  • My Top 10 Favorite 90+ Point Cabernet Sauvingnons from (name of your wine delivery membership)
  • Best Cocktail Bars in 10 US Cities I’ve Visited
  • Most Scenic Botanical Gardens in North America
  • 5 Simple Energy-Packed Breakfast Recipes for Busy Moms
  • One Simple Magic Trick to Entertain and Impress Your Customers

6. Short Selfie Video Series

Make short videos with your phone sharing some of your best advice or stories. You can house the videos on a page that you only give access to subscribers. First, upload them to your YouTube channel then embed them on the page.

This involves less editing and many of your subscribers may wish to see your face and hear your voice.

This can come from personal experiences, business or personal ideas you’d like to try, questions you have for your audience to start a conversation, FAQs just to name a few.

Here are some real-life examples of short selfie video series freebies:

  • 3 Changes I Made to FINALLY Start Boosting 100+ Visitors a Day to My Blog
  • ONE Change I Made in My LIfe to Lose 20 Lbs in the Last 3 Months
  • 3 Flirtiest Texts to Send Your Man to Drive Him Wild
  • 5 Questions to Get Your Customers to Engage in Conversation
  • ONE Thing I Changed in (Year) to Get My Kids to ACTUALLY Listen and Help with Chores

7. Checklists

We need a list of supplies or action steps to complete many tasks. This is where checklists come in handy. You can easily create checklists with Word or Google Docs, but the most visually appealing-looking ones I’ve built with Canva.com.

This is one of the easiest and sought out freebies to giveaway.

Check out these checklist ideas you can offer as a freebie on your blog or social media pages:

  • Tools needed to complete a task
  • Art supplies for a project
  • Ingredients for a recipe
  • Emergency prep supplies and equipment
  • Basic pages and posts to start a blog
  • First 10 pages and posts to publish for a travel blog
  • Best sites to see in (name of city)
  • Best breweries, cocktail bars, or wine bars to visit in (name of city)
  • What you need to create your first online video

8. Puzzles

Create fun crossword puzzles, word searches, or vocabulary images-to-word-matching puzzles. I’ve created these for an old Spanish-teaching blog but Canva makes the job much easier.

Make it more interesting to offer scoreboards for bragging rights when you can.

Check out these simple freebie ideas for puzzles you could give away as a freebie on your blog or social media pages:

  • Opposites for foreign language
  • Word soup of travel destinations
  • Unscramble words for cooking terms
  • Match image to vocabulary for 50+ year old adults beginning bloggers
  • Reorder steps for recipes

9. Printable Cards

Date idea cards, vocabulary cards, recipe cards, etc. make for one of the most favorable freebies to giveaway to new subscribers.

Here’s one I jumped into heavily and created not only freebie lead magnets but Etsy products for sale.

Check out this list of printable cards ideas:

  • Birthday
  • Baby Shower Game
  • Name Cards for Wedding Reception Tables
  • First Date Ideas
  • Vacation Activity Cards and Box for First Anniversary Trip
  • Jokes to Cheer People Up
  • Get Well Soon
  • Filing System

10. Printable Labels

Address labels, gift tags, motivational quote stickers, food labels, brand labels templates, salutations, etc.

Your subscribers simply download them then print them on sticker paper sheets.

Look at these examples of freebie printable labels you could give away:

  • Dry Goods
  • Condiments
  • Christmas Gift Tags
  • St Patick’s Day Stickers
  • Valentine’s Day Stickers
  • Treasure Hunt Stickers (Directions to lead a loved one to hidden gift location)
  • Laptop Stickers
  • Famous Quotes from Walt Disney

Best Keywords for Dating and Relationship Blog Posts

Running into a creativity wall?

Looking for new ideas to grow traffic and attract new visitors?

Check out my list of some of the best keywords for dating and relationship blog posts.

Not sure what topics to focus on for your dating and relationship blog- try these relationship blog keywords!

Besides SEO, keywords serve another vital purpose for your blog.

Headline attention-grabbers!

Headlines located within the search results of Google can attract clicks to beat out the competition.

And they can do the same on visual social media platforms such as Pinterest and Instagram (but especially Pinterest).

Only testing different keyword combinations will reveal which works best, with the help of some research.

But without a doubt, certain keywords and keywords phrases tend to get more clickthroughs than others.

My most successful Pins and blog posts typically contain either a combination of two keywords or three.

Then from there, you can insert “long-tail keyword phrases” throughout your posts by adding words to the beginning or end of these combinations.

New Blog Post Ideas for Couples Travel on Your Love Blog

Right now some poor girl is stressing out scouring the internet for ideas on the next trip she and her boyfriend will take, but she won’t find your blog.

Because you’ve got nothing on (or very little) the topic of travel.

That’s why you need this list of new blog post ideas for couples travel for your dating and relationship blog.

Why Add Couples Travel on Your Dating and Relationship Blog?

We all tend to lean on other people’s travel experiences before exploring a new vacation destination on our own.

Yes, we may ready reviews on travel apps such as Skyscanner, Travelocity, or Expedia, we still value the opinion of real people and not just businessy sites.

Plus the search engines are packed with travel blogs and so are Pinterest and Instagram, so why even bother?

Because all it takes is the right combination of words and images to attract your audience’s attention and wrestle it away from your competition.

And think about this.

There are tens of thousands of vacation possibilities out there, if not more.

You just have to find a new mix of blog post ideas for couples travel and you can stand out.

The places you’ve gone or want to go, chances are someone would love to take you up on your recommendations out there on the internet, and you a click away from publishing your ideas.

Someone with similar tastes wants you to publish them and find you.

But before you throw any old idea up on your blog, brainstorm some first…

First, start with…

General Travel Ideas for Couples

Don’t begin too specific because the audience for it likely will be very small.

Instead, start more broad and make a relatively large list of travel ideas for couples.

This all depends on how much time and energy you have to write.

But if you can stretch it to 25-50 then you will have a lot more keyword combinations that could appear on search engines.

Plus, for Pinterest, you will have more images that you could make to add to your Boards.

Starting broader allows for a wider range of ideas.

Find locations that get good reviews and a lot of engaged viewers leaving comments.

Aim to increase your value in your viewers’ eyes by providing a mix of both popular known places and interesting unique places not many have heard of (but still get high reviews).

They want ideas that they have forgotten about or have not thought of themselves.

Three More Things to Consider for Blog Post Ideas for Couples Travel

I hope that just the lists of headlines alone have given you ideas for content, but one step you might consider before brainstorming for locations is the angle that you take to write the posts.

Come from your own personal experience or interest.

Haven’t traveled the globe yet?

No sweat.

Don’t see yourself as a globetrotter or jetsetter?

No big deal.

Your visitors just want ideas for their trips.

1. Writing from Your Own Personal Experience

Makes it easier to tell the story of anticipation and excitement leading up to your first time going to a new city and then sharing your stories and observations from stop to stop. When possible share your own pictures, people want to relate to your real-life experience.

2. Wishlist Travel Destinations

Who says you have to write about places you’ve only been to?

Point out the places where you want to go this year or next.

Ask your visitors or subscribers to share with you their suggestions of where to go.

3. Bucket List Travel Destinations

Share with your audience the BIG TICKET places you’d like to visit in your lifetime or events you wish to experience in person.

Ask your audience who has already done so and what they liked most.

When creating any content on your relationship blog you do NOT have to take the angle of personal experience every time.

If all of us bloggers chose that road we wouldn’t have much to write about.

Remember, your blog can serve as an expression of your life’s journey.

Combine your desires and dreams with your own personal first-hand stories. In fact, don’t be afraid to combine them in the same posts.

What’s wrong with creating a list post of 25 Romantic Christmas Season Getaways for Couples in (Year) or 15 Scenic Summer North America Road Trips for Couples and sharing which you’ve done and the rest you want to do in the same post?
